2007 Chrysler 300 vs. 1979 Oldsmobile Toronado
To start off, 2007 Chrysler 300 is newer by 28 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1979 Oldsmobile Toronado.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1979 Oldsmobile Toronado would be higher. At 6,059 cc (8 cylinders), 2007 Chrysler 300 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Chrysler 300 (429 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 306 more horse power than 1979 Oldsmobile Toronado. (123 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 Chrysler 300 should accelerate faster than 1979 Oldsmobile Toronado.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Chrysler 300 weights approximately 188 kg more than 1979 Oldsmobile Toronado.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2007 Chrysler 300 (569 Nm @ 4800 RPM) has 291 more torque (in Nm) than 1979 Oldsmobile Toronado. (278 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2007 Chrysler 300 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1979 Oldsmobile Toronado.
